SKR 1.3 / 1.4 Klipper固件
SKR 1.3和SKR 1.4的固件更新过程相同,因此已合并了指南。
必填项
- Klipper必须安装在Raspberry Pi上
- 根据控制器的数量,至少需要一张microSD卡。
构建固件映像
- 登录到Raspberry Pi
- 运行以下命令:
sudo apt install make
cd ~/klipper
make menuconfig
在菜单结构中,有许多项目可供选择。
- 确保将微控制器架构选择为“ LPC176x”
- 如果SKR是Turbo型号,请确保选择120MHz。
- 如果SKR是非Turbo型号,请确保选择100MHz。
- 启用“目标板使用Smoothieware引导程序”
- 启用“使用USB进行通信(而不是串行)”
选择配置后,如果要求保存配置,请选择“退出”和“是”。
运行以下命令:
make clean
make
该make
命令完成后,将创建一个固件文件klipper.bin,该文件存储在folder中/home/pi/klipper/out
。该文件需要复制到两个SKR板上。最简单的方法是使用Windows上的WinSCP之类的GUI或Mac上的Cyberduck或scp(从终端)将文件复制到你的计算机。
加载固件映像
将klipper.bin复制到桌面,然后将其重命名为firmware.bin
重要信息:如果未重命名文件,则引导加载程序将无法正确更新。
确保未为所有SKR板供电,然后卸下已安装的microSD卡。
使用firmware.bin文件将其中一张microSD卡连接到计算机。在文件浏览器中打开microSC卡。将有一个名为“ firmware.cur”的文件,该文件可以删除或保留,以后将被覆盖。
从桌面将firmware.bin复制到microSD卡上。如果在将文件传输到microSD卡时遇到问题,请使用FAT32文件系统重新格式化microSD卡,然后重试。
V2:对第二张microSD卡重复该过程。
将microSD卡插入SKR。如果不止一个,则哪个卡插入哪个控制器都没有关系。
接通电源以接通SKR板的电源。如果命名正确,SKR将自动使用Klipper固件进行更新。
重要提示:如果未使用12-24V为SKR供电,则Klipper将无法通过UART与TMC驱动程序通信,并且SKR将自动关闭。
请先
!